In 2020-2021, 11,796 people earned their degree in general engineering, making the major the 79th most popular in the United States. In 2019-2020, general engineering graduates who were awarded their degree in 2017-2019, earned an average of $68,873 and had an average of $20,557 in loans still to pay off.
Across Missouri, there were 175 general engineering graduates with average earnings and debt of $54,112 and $23,250 respectively. At the master’s degree level specifically, there were 45 general engineering graduates with average earnings and debt of $53,301 and $0 respectively.
For this year’s “Schools for a Master’s Highly Focused on Engineering Major in Missouri” ranking, we looked at 2 colleges that offer a degree in general engineering. This a ranking of the schools where the largest percentage of students has enrolled in general engineering.
